Transaction 17479ebaa698565fdcb9432a1d7023a20f963d8f2d709c46365f6bdaeed4b6ee
1 Input
1 Output
-
17479ebaa698565fdcb9432a1d7023a20f963d8f2d709c46365f6bdaeed4b6ee:0
- value
- 31393980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8d6dc22d966bac8ca5fdc295aebc366dfd8a51b OP_EQUAL
- address
- 3NvA5mzEXhwKyPiupuat5ejU2M4f15U2XK